Movement Alert|MaxLinear Falls 7.23% in Regular Trading, Post-Earnings Profit-Taking Intensified by Broad Semiconductor Selloff

Market Focus
07/28

On July 28, MaxLinear fell 7.23% in regular trading, trading at $57.43/share, with turnover of $78.30 million.

Despite delivering Q2 results and Q3 guidance that both exceeded expectations, the stock continues to face intense profit-taking pressure. MaxLinear reported adjusted EPS of $0.35, beating the consensus estimate of $0.33, while revenue of $168.8 million surpassed the expected $164.6 million. Q3 revenue guidance of $210-$220 million significantly exceeded analyst expectations of $173.9 million. However, the stock had surged over 20% in the three trading days prior to the earnings release, with optimistic expectations already fully priced in.

Adding to the selling pressure, the semiconductor sector experienced a broad decline on the same day. Micron Technology fell 10.26%, SK Hynix dropped 9.84%, Advanced Micro Devices declined 8.96%, and Intel lost 7.66%, with sector-wide selling amplifying MaxLinear's pullback.
